Sopheakmith Waterfall holds a significant place in local folklore and history. The falls have long been a source of life and sustenance for the communities living along the Mekong River. The strong currents and rapids around the waterfall have also played a role in shaping the river's ecosystem and influencing the lives of the people who depend on it. While swimming is not recommended due to the strong currents, visitors can enjoy the stunning views of the waterfall from various vantage points along the riverbank. Boat trips are available, allowing you to get closer to the falls and experience the power of the Mekong. Exploring the surrounding area offers opportunities to discover local villages and learn about the traditional way of life along the river. Transportation

Reaching Sopheakmith Waterfall requires some planning. From Stung Treng town, you can hire a tuk-tuk or motorbike to take you to the area near the falls. The journey involves some off-road travel, so a sturdy vehicle is recommended. Alternatively, you can arrange a boat trip from Stung Treng town that includes a visit to the waterfall.
